> Yep, this is the right place. Let's see...
> 
> $ host gnomejournal.org
> gnomejournal.org has address 12.107.209.247
> $ host 12.107.209.247
> 247.209.107.12.in-addr.arpa domain name pointer window.gnome.org.
> $ host window.gnome.org
> window.gnome.org has address 209.132.176.176
> 
> Aha. DNS is out-of-date.
> 
> $ whois gnomejournal.org
> ...
> Tech Name:Jorge Castro
> Tech Email:[EMAIL PROTECTED]
> Name Server:NS1.EASYDNS.COM
> ...
> 
> Jorge, we recently moved the gnome.org servers to a new colo facility,
> and they've got new IP addresses. gnomejournal.org is still pointing
> at the old IP address. Please update your DNS accordingly.
